Our verdict is Benign. Variant got -9 ACMG points: 0P and 9B. BP4_StrongBS1_SupportingBS2
The NM_182914.3(SYNE2):c.10597C>G(p.Gln3533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000434 in 1,614,176 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Emery-Dreifuss muscular dystrophy 5, autosomal dominant Uncertain:1
This sequence change replaces glutamine, which is neutral and polar, with glutamic acid, which is acidic and polar, at codon 3533 of the SYNE2 protein (p.Gln3533Glu). This variant is present in population databases (rs200040718, gnomAD 0.02%). This variant has not been reported in the literature in individuals affected with SYNE2-related conditions. ClinVar contains an entry for this variant (Variation ID: 470913). An algorithm developed to predict the effect of missense changes on protein structure and function outputs the following: PolyPhen-2: "Benign". The glutamic acid amino acid residue is found in multiple mammalian species, which suggests that this missense change does not adversely affect protein function.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
